Output 4c90754c35cb0796f7aac7fa81d563dbfdfa9fe3ffc400da441c0ddcb6f7be97:1

value
2811017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e4f7fb9b99c58e3821b0f18b41ed1a13cbad6f9 OP_EQUAL
address
3G85vXzyfqxdjEo5oszrFobsKGZVvqczEz
transaction
4c90754c35cb0796f7aac7fa81d563dbfdfa9fe3ffc400da441c0ddcb6f7be97
confirmations
168766
spent
true